We all love a Costco run for new deals and items, but are these new Costco bar cakes worth the hype? In this video, we gave the two newest flavors a spin: Waffle Cone and Peaches and Cream. Both bar cakes brought something new to the table, but can they stand up against the OG Tuxedo bar cake? And you know we couldn’t try them without the classic Costco hot dog as a palette cleanser. 00:00And we're back with another foodie adventure at Costco. Today, I'm headed straight to their bakery
00:05to try their two new bar cakes, the waffle cone and the peaches and cream. The peaches and cream
00:09cake had layers of vanilla cake, whipped cream, peach filling, and then it was topped with white
00:14chocolate curls. To be honest, I thought the peach flavor came off a little fakey. The waffle cone
00:20bar cake has way more going on than I actually thought. Whipped cream cheese frosting, drizzles
00:25of chocolate and caramel, waffle cone pieces, and then of course, a few really cute waffle
00:30cone butts filled with frosting. I had to compare the two newbies to the OG tuxedo cake. This
00:37one has layers of chocolate cake, dark chocolate and white chocolate mousse, brownie chunks,
00:41and the whole thing is finished with chocolate binoche. All three of the bar cakes were good,
00:45but the OG tuxedo cake is just so hard to beat. And to answer to my intrusive thoughts, yes,
00:51of course. I tried each one with the hot dog. Would I do it again? I'm not in a rush
00:56to,
00:56but I'm not mad I tried.
